• RFF75E8505EA Automotive Cooling System Water Pump For Ford 3L3Z8501DB F65Z8501AC 6U7X8501B
  • RFF75E8505EA Automotive Cooling System Water Pump For Ford 3L3Z8501DB F65Z8501AC 6U7X8501B
  • RFF75E8505EA Automotive Cooling System Water Pump For Ford 3L3Z8501DB F65Z8501AC 6U7X8501B
  • RFF75E8505EA Automotive Cooling System Water Pump For Ford 3L3Z8501DB F65Z8501AC 6U7X8501B
  • RFF75E8505EA Automotive Cooling System Water Pump For Ford 3L3Z8501DB F65Z8501AC 6U7X8501B
  • RFF75E8505EA Automotive Cooling System Water Pump For Ford 3L3Z8501DB F65Z8501AC 6U7X8501B
  • RFF75E8505EA Automotive Cooling System Water Pump For Ford 3L3Z8501DB F65Z8501AC 6U7X8501B
  • RFF75E8505EA Automotive Cooling System Water Pump For Ford 3L3Z8501DB F65Z8501AC 6U7X8501B

RFF75E8505EA Automotive Cooling System Water Pump For Ford 3L3Z8501DB F65Z8501AC 6U7X8501B

Negotiable
1 (Min.Order)
  • 1000 per Month
  • T/T Credit Card